  • Mission

    The Hattie M. Strong Foundation provides scholarships to teacher candidates during their student teacher semester, supports former scholarship recipients with classroom materials grants, and provides grants to out-of-school time organizations in the DMV.

    About Us

    HMSF was founded in 1928, by the indomitable Hattie M. Strong. The Foundation focuses on strengthening opportunities within the education system through a grant program (serving out-of-school time programs in the DMV) and the Strong Scholars Program, which provides funds to selected colleges and universities to award scholarships to students training to be teachers, in their student teacher semesters. In addition, former Strong Scholars can apply for classroom materials grants, to support their entry into the teaching profession. over 1400 teachers in training have benefitted from these programs.
